This is a small artisan bakery near Kendal in Cumbria which we discovered in a documentary about the Lake District last year. We have been there several times – essentially every time we are one our way to Windermere. In fact, it is now a compulsory stop for us every time we are in the area, which is several times a year. Their items are divine and unique; there several breads, loaves and buns, all sourdough, and other goodies (including pastries) amply listed on their website. Service is very friendly and obliging, and no request is too much for them. Items tend to run out at around lunch time after which it becomes pot luck. We particularly adore their Five Grain bread, Spiced apple and sultana bread, almond croissants, and bear claws (almond and coffee pastry), but the list will grow as we are steadily working our way through their entire repertoire. Nearby is Rinaldo’s Coffee, possibly the best you can find in the UK, which seems an ideal partner with the bakery’s products. The small bakery is situated in an enclave of a few other shops, Plumgarths Farm Shop & their “2 sisters” Café, Ginger Bakery, etc. Somewhat pricey but the superb quality overrides that. This mini business park between Kendal and Windermere is well worth visiting to stock up on goodies and grab lunch or coffee from the several foods outlets. Lovingly makes outstanding (award winning) sourdough breads and the range (rye, focaccia, cinnamon buns) covers most eventualities. Organic and locally sourced. Everyone is super friendly and the hands-on owners are passionate about provenance, product, and community. Can also be found at Kendal farmers' market.
